Description
Been playing Hero of the Kingdom II for a couple months now. It’s basically a strategy game where you build up your village, train troops, and raid other players. Pretty solid app if you’re into that sort of thing.
Here’s what you do: You can explore the kingdom, help out the locals with quests, and unlock new skills like fishing and hunting. There’s also clan wars, which is pretty fun – you team up with friends and try to take down enemy villages. Takes some strategy but it’s not rocket science.
Look, if you’re into base building and PVP, you’ll probably like this. It’s not perfect – the upgrades take forever at higher levels and the ads can be annoying if you don’t pay. But overall it does the job. Worth checking out.
